diff options
author | Matt Wilson <msw@redhat.com> | 2000-03-06 23:15:01 +0000 |
---|---|---|
committer | Matt Wilson <msw@redhat.com> | 2000-03-06 23:15:01 +0000 |
commit | 0ce1f81cdd9a3eee21a422ea57b8235914db0373 (patch) | |
tree | 141ef3052652aa8a0cde09b6b848d33222ccb380 /loader/lang.c | |
parent | 242cd8ac2013210df7413c8bab0a9843d77216dc (diff) | |
download | anaconda-0ce1f81cdd9a3eee21a422ea57b8235914db0373.tar.gz anaconda-0ce1f81cdd9a3eee21a422ea57b8235914db0373.tar.xz anaconda-0ce1f81cdd9a3eee21a422ea57b8235914db0373.zip |
fix for fonts from jj
Diffstat (limited to 'loader/lang.c')
-rw-r--r-- | loader/lang.c | 9 |
1 files changed, 5 insertions, 4 deletions
diff --git a/loader/lang.c b/loader/lang.c index 306c2ae82..ca0948770 100644 --- a/loader/lang.c +++ b/loader/lang.c @@ -187,6 +187,7 @@ static int loadFont(char * fontFile, int flags) { gzFile stream; int rc; + if (!strcmp(fontFile, "None")) return 0; #if 0 if (!FL_TESTING(flags)) { #endif @@ -239,8 +240,8 @@ void setLanguage (char * key) { setenv("LC_ALL", languages[i].lc_all, 1); setenv("LINGUAS", languages[i].key, 1); loadLanguage (NULL, 0); - if (languages[i].font) - loadFont(languages[i].font, 0); + if (languages[i].map) + loadFont(languages[i].map, 0); break; } } @@ -300,8 +301,8 @@ int chooseLanguage(char ** lang, int flags) { } loadLanguage (NULL, flags); - if (languages[choice].font) - loadFont(languages[choice].font, flags); + if (languages[choice].map) + loadFont(languages[choice].map, flags); return 0; } |